Transaction 005217e65e45c6808c8f10635ae1ee13ef2dde40ef14e25bdc14eb24732bfc28

3 Input
2 Outputs
  • 005217e65e45c6808c8f10635ae1ee13ef2dde40ef14e25bdc14eb24732bfc28:0
  • value  70595
    address  15u1uwL4kaEYPgQQ7XyDPHwPQCdMydbLBC
  • 005217e65e45c6808c8f10635ae1ee13ef2dde40ef14e25bdc14eb24732bfc28:1
  • value  915500
    address  3FWuBbEN8ZsqtsxCMBVxZ2AuUfqqgMGWXT